Code p0420

I just got a code p0420 on my 04 Legacy (86,000 miles). I know this points to the cat but is that definitive? Could it be a bad O2 sensor or something else? What are my options here? This is an unmodified daily driver, by my wife, so major mods are out of the question.

Re: Code p0420

Ouch. I just got a new cat with that code under the federal emissions warranty, which goes to 80,000 miles. So you just missed that.

The cats just burn out after a while, and our smart friends at Subaru (and most other car makers, too) made them just good enough to get past the mark.

When it's cool, reach under and bang on it and see if there's anything rattling in the pipes. When they go bad, the guts degrade and flow downstream.
